Type of service: Autism Partnership Board

Local autism partnership boards (APBs) or similar organisations have been set up in order to implement the adult autism strategy, which says it is essential that adults with autism and parents/carers are involved in the development of local services. The Boards aim to bring together different organisations, services and stakeholders locally and set a clear direction for improved services, including health and social care.
